> All at the same time?? No, but it doesn't matter. If 10,000,000 people need to use 60,000 beds, and they each use one for three weeks, that's 500 weeks, almost ten years. Even if you could get a ventilator for all of them, Chinese experience is that about half of the vented patients die. Hopefully in a year and a half or so we'll have a vaccine. Until then we need to keep the case counts low, first by sequestering ourselves to get the numbers down, and then by other, less draconian means once the case counts are in single/double digits. |
